🌴 Seminyak: Stylish Comfort Meets Family Fun
Seminyak is renowned for its vibrant atmosphere, upscale dining, and chic boutiques. It’s a perfect blend of relaxation and adventure for families.
- The Legian Bali: This beachfront resort offers spacious suites and villas, some with private pools. Families can enjoy the serene beach, the resort’s kids’ club, and the convenience of nearby restaurants and shops.
- Alila Villas Seminyak: An eco-friendly resort featuring private villas with pools, Alila offers a range of family services, including babysitting and family concierge, ensuring a comfortable stay for all ages.

🌊 Sanur: Tranquil Beaches and Cultural Charm
Sanur offers calm beaches and a laid-back atmosphere, ideal for families seeking relaxation and cultural experiences.
- InterContinental Bali Sanur Resort: Set amidst lush tropical gardens, this resort features spacious suites and villas, some with private pools. Families can enjoy the resort’s kids’ club, beachfront dining, and cultural activities.

🌅 Jimbaran Bay: Beachfront Luxury and Family-Friendly Amenities
Jimbaran Bay is known for its stunning sunsets, calm waters, and luxurious resorts.

- AYANA Villas Bali: Perched on a clifftop overlooking Jimbaran Bay, AYANA offers luxurious villas with private pools, 14 public pools, and a range of dining options. Families can enjoy the resort’s kids’ club and cultural activities.

🌿 Ubud: Cultural Immersion and Wellness Retreats
Ubud is the cultural heart of Bali, offering lush landscapes and spiritual experiences.

- Mandapa, a Ritz-Carlton Reserve: Set along the Ayung River, Mandapa offers luxurious villas and suites, a spa, and cultural activities like Balinese cooking classes and traditional dance performances.
- Anantara Ubud Bali Resort: This resort combines modern luxury with Balinese heritage, featuring spacious villas, an infinity pool, and cultural experiences like rice paddy walks and temple visits.

🌊 Uluwatu: Cliffside Luxury and Family Adventures
Uluwatu offers dramatic cliffs, world-class surf, and luxurious resorts with panoramic ocean views.

- Anantara Uluwatu Bali Resort: This resort offers luxurious villas with ocean views, a kids’ club, and family-friendly dining options, making it ideal for families seeking relaxation and adventure.



🧳 Tips for Booking Your Family Stay in Bali
- Consider Room Configurations: Look for suites or villas with multiple bedrooms or interconnecting rooms to accommodate your family’s needs.
- Check for Kids’ Amenities: Ensure the resort offers facilities like kids’ clubs, children’s pools, and family-friendly dining options.
- Plan Activities: Research the resort’s offerings for family activities, such as cultural experiences, nature excursions, and wellness programs.
